Mohsen's professional soccer journey began in 2010 when he made his debut with Petrojet SC in the Egyptian Premier League. He quickly made a name for himself as a talented striker, showcasing his skills and scoring abilities on the field. Mohsen's impressive performances caught the attention of many, leading to a successful club career with Petrojet SC from 2010 to 2014.
In 2016, Mohsen signed with Al Ahly, one of the most prestigious and successful clubs in Egyptian soccer history. This move marked a significant milestone in his career, as he continued to excel and contribute to his team's success on the field.
Not only has Mohsen shone in his club career, but he has also represented Egypt on the international stage. In 2012, he played in the Toulon Tournament and the Olympics with Egypt's senior squad, showcasing his talent and skills on a global platform.
In 2018, Mohsen earned a spot on Egypt's FIFA World Cup squad, where he played a crucial role as a striker. His performance and dedication on the field further solidified his position as a valuable asset to the national team.
